    I don't think I'd like to see MGM take over the casino operations because my rotation on a trip is some combination of Cosmo-CET-MGM and it would throw off flexibility on how I arrange the stays, CET would always have to be in the middle due to no back-to-backing of MGM offers.

    The two Gold tier-based comp nights at Cosmo would probably go away, as would the 2x slot points multiplier and the 5% rebate on spend.

    I would probably end up making Platinum at MLife, but that ain't really worth much.
